All proteins, such as the protein you consume and the protein in your physique, are created from some combination of 20 amino acids . Your physique can create 11 of these AAs, creating them nonessential amino acids . Your physique can’t generate the other 9, which are as a result important amino acids you should get by means of food.

The effects of whey protein on blood pressure are not nicely established, but a single study explored what happened when persons with obesity supplemented their diet plan with whey protein. After 12 weeks, those who incorporated whey protein had reduced blood pressure and improved vascular function.

In truth, there appears to be a continuum for proteins with some, where 1 structure dominates to other individuals that are fully disordered and superior described as a dynamic ensemble of unstructured conformations. Hexokinase and other proteins in basic are not just limited to a handful of conformational states, as an alternative proteins are greater thought of as dynamic molecules undergoing exchange between states. They are continually undergoing motions where atoms vibrate, bonds wiggle and at instances much more important fluctuations take place as the protein samples other attainable conformations. These structural modifications and dynamic motions are critical for substrate binding and many other functions. With pc simulations, we are beginning to visualise the comprehensive course of action in actual-time, in molecular motion pictures generated by molecular dynamic simulations. These movies highlight why folding, structure, dynamics and interactions are central to understanding protein biology.

When we eat protein-containing foods (such as meat, fish, beans, eggs, cheese, and so forth.) the polypeptide chains are frequently broken down in the digestive tract and the person amino acids are absorbed into our bodies. These amino acids are then recombined into proteins precise to each person person in a course of action known as protein synthesis.
